Switzerland-Germany drop off car rental fee
I will be driving from Zurich to central Germany in June. If the car rental is in Switzerland, will the drop off fee be brutal? Is it even worth considering taking a train to Konstanz or another border town in Germany to rent the car?

>>>I will be driving from Zurich to central Germany in June. If the car rental is in Switzerland, will the drop off fee be brutal?<<<
It often is very high. Just about everywhere in Europe, cross border drop offs are expensive.

I am not sure what you are looking for. Is it more than just a matter of going to whichever car rental company web site and ask for a quote? Do you need a help in doing this? I just went to the Hertz site, entered ZRH to FRA rental, 6/13-6/20 for a compact and it spit out 379CHF drop off fee, in additional to everything else, in less than a minute.

I had a look at a couple of car hire websites too, and those that allow cross border hire had what i considered very high fees for doing so, so I agree with neckervd that if you want to do this, get a train to a place just over the German border and hire from there.
